How borrowing works locally
A lender is free to set its own price below the legal ceiling, and it does so according to the risk it reads in the file.
A deposit or trade-in reduces the amount financed and therefore the interest charged over the term. An application usually asks for identification, income evidence, banking details and a statement of obligations.

The census figures for Midland
In the 2021 Census, Midland had 17,817 residents. The community covers 35.3 square kilometres of land.
Population divided by land area produces a density of 504.3 people per square kilometre.
The 2021 Census population places it at rank 99 in the province.

The Ontario rules that apply
The body that licenses consumer lending in Ontario is the regulator named on the feder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114)'s list of provincial and territorial regulators.
The federal payday lending regulations, SOR/2024-114, cap the cost of borrowing at $14 per $100 advanced in Ontario, which the feder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114) list as a province that regulates the product.
